Erica Lindbeck's Experience
5.1 The Incident
Recently, popular voice actress Erica Lindbeck found herself at the center of a controversy surrounding the use of her voice to create AI-generated videos on YouTube. Lindbeck requested that the video be taken down, citing concerns over the unauthorized usage of her voice. Unfortunately, this led to her being harassed online, eventually leading her to deactivate all her social media accounts. The incident sparked a heated debate on Twitter, with supporters and detractors discussing the rights and boundaries of voice actors when it comes to AI-generated content.
5.2 Response from Fans and Peers
In response to the incident, many fans and peers of Erica Lindbeck voiced their support for her. They acknowledged her concerns about the potential negative impact of AI-generated videos featuring her voice on her career opportunities. This incident also shed light on the broader issue of respect and consent in using AI to replicate someone's voice or artistic talents.
The Debate Around Voice Actors' Rights
6.1 Voice Actor's Perspective
The debate surrounding the rights of voice actors in relation to AI-generated content is multifaceted. Some argue that voice actors have the right to protect their voices from unauthorized usage, as it is an integral part of their artistic identity. They assert that the misuse of AI-generated content can potentially harm their reputations and future employment prospects. Voice actors like Erica Lindbeck have expressed their discomfort and concerns about AI-generated covers using their voices without consent.
6.2 Fan Perspective
On the other side of the debate, some argue that the use of AI-generated covers is a form of transformative art. They believe that using AI to create unique interpretations of existing content is a valid way to engage with and appreciate art. In this view, AI-generated content is seen as a means of creative expression rather than a form of infringement.
